Understanding Membrane Switch Modern Technology



Membrane switch technology might appear complicated, it operates on uncomplicated principles that boost customer interfaces in various devices. This technology consists of slim, flexible layers that produce an incorporated circuit, enabling seamless communication in between the tool and the individual. Commonly, a membrane switch consists of a visuals overlay, a spacer, and a circuit layer, all developed to supply a long lasting and efficient service for regulating digital functions.The graphic overlay, often printed with dynamic designs, offers aesthetic guidance while functioning as the main touch surface area. Below it, the spacer layer keeps the circuit layer and overlay separated till pressure is used, completing the circuit. When an individual presses a button, the layers enter into call, resulting in an electrical signal that triggers the device. This simplicity, incorporated with convenience, allows Membrane buttons to be efficiently utilized in a wide variety of applications, from consumer electronics to commercial equipment.

Toughness and Dependability of Membrane Changes



Membrane switches exhibit exceptional durability and integrity, making them a preferred selection in different applications. Created from durable materials such as polyester or polycarbonate, these switches are made to hold up against severe ecological conditions, consisting of severe temperatures, dampness, and exposure to chemicals. Their secured layout stops dirt and particles from disrupting performance, making certain consistent performance over time.Additionally, Membrane switches can sustain millions of actuations, showing their durable nature. This long life lowers the requirement for regular substitutes, inevitably decreasing maintenance costs. Their compact and lightweight design additionally boosts their reliability in space-constrained settings, such as clinical devices and industrial equipment.Moreover, Membrane switches are resistant to fading, scratching, and other types of wear, keeping visual appeal and capability throughout their life-span. This combination of sturdiness and integrity makes Membrane switches over an ideal service for applications needing both performance and durability.
